EXIF Reader is packaged with @nodegui/packer.
This has already been run for macOS, but you'll need to run it for other platforms.
npx nodegui-packer --init 'EXIF Reader'This creates the deploy directory with a template. Here you can add icons, change the app name, description and add other native features or dependencies. Make sure you commit this directory.
Creates the JavaScript bundle along with assets inside the dist directory:
npm run buildBuild the distributable based on the template, the output is in the /deploy/<platform>/build directory (ignored in git):
